F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E SAADIA ALI ASCHEMANN’S THIRD VOLUME OF POETRY, VICE & VERSE, IS RELEASED DURING NATIONAL POETRY MONTH Award Winning Poet is looking forward to promoting her third book. 
QUINCY, IL – April 2010– What happens when a suburban wife and mother of two explores thoughts and ideas that are decidedly provocative? Award winning poet, Saadia Ali Aschemann, answers questions like this and more in Vice & Verse (Firefly Publishing, $14.00), a collection of eighty (80) poems that explore different styles, forms and themes. Vice & Verse is the third volume of relevant observations and interpretations of the way we live our lives today.  Saadia not only draws the reader into her poems through contemporary themes, but also gently guides the reader through sonnet structure and haiku habits. Saadia muses about attraction, a lover’s inattentiveness, sin, seduction and the curious habits of children lost in play. Along the way, she throws back the curtain and lets the reader see the magic behind her work with exquisite explanations of poetic form that accompany many of her entries.  Saadia is the recipient of the Preditors & Editors “Best Poet” award as well as a finalist for Southern Illinois University’s Devil’s Kitchen Reading award.
Saadia’s newest volume of poetry, Vice & Verse, is nothing short of a burning and furious romance with words and daily life. She writes about home, insomnia and conversation. Saadia manages to capture thoughts that flash through her mind after updating her twitter feed but before running car pool for her children. Vice & Verse is a deliciously mature x-ray of the soul of today’s woman. Mother, daughter, wife and author, Saadia shares her deepest insights with regard to the world around her with a growing readership.  Singer and songwriter, Garland Jeffreys says of Saadia’s mix of vice and verse, “her words make me feel like I’m an immediate inhabitant of her world. I like the feeling and want more. She teaches and takes me to a place I want to go.”  Kevin Doyle, bestselling author, exclaims, “Finally! A third volume from provocative Saadia…as usual, a superior example of bold, daring American womanhood.”   Saadia Ali Aschemann is a member of the adjunct faculty at Culver-Stockton college where she teaches Fundamentals of Speech.  She received her undergraduate degree from George Mason University in Fairfax, Virginia and her masters degree in education from the University of Illinois.   Her first collection of poetry, lavish lines/luscious lies was released by Firefly Publishing in 2007.  Her second volume, Words Gone Wild, was presented to her eager public in 2008.  She is currently working on a novel and plans to promote her work at BookExpo America in New York City next month. Saadia’s books are available online and at nationwide retailers.Locally, Vice & Verse is carried by Great Debate Books and Waldenbooks.
